Removing Hyphen(s)
I have numbers separated by Hyphen(s) and I am looking for an easy way to
remove the Hyphen and just leave the text My data could be 1410-4031 or 1469-1555-043 Thanks -- ce |

Removing Hyphen(s)
Highlight the cells and use Find & Replace (CTRL-H) - Find hyphen and
